    Hace 22 horas · Poland, officially the Republic of Poland, is a country in Central Europe. Poland is divided into sixteen voivodeships and is the fifth-most populous member state of the European Union (EU), with over 38 million people, and the seventh-largest EU country , covering a combined area of 312,696 km 2 (120,733 sq mi).
